Right Side of the Plane

The right side offers the most iconic views of the Madeira archipelago upon departure and a clear view of the Glasgow urban landscape during arrival.

Right Side Highlights
8.4
๐Ÿ˜๏ธ

Funchal Amphitheater

The stunning sight of Funchal's white houses climbing the steep green volcanic slopes right after departure.

๐Ÿ๏ธ

Porto Santo Island

The neighboring island featuring a massive 9km golden sand beach contrasted against vibrant turquoise waters.

๐Ÿ‡ช๐Ÿ‡ธ

Galician Coastline

Distant views of the 'Rias' or flooded valleys along the northwestern coast of Spain during the mid-flight transit.

๐ŸŽก

Isle of Man

Aerial perspective of the Isle of Man and the busy shipping lanes of the Irish Sea as the aircraft enters UK airspace.

๐Ÿ™๏ธ

Glasgow City Center

A bird's eye view of the SEC Armadillo, the Hydro, and the historic grid layout of the city center on final approach.

The right side is unbeatable for the initial 15 minutes of the flight; ensure your window is clear for the Porto Santo fly-past. During the Glasgow approach, look for the 'Squinty Bridge' and the historic shipyards along the River Clyde.

Left Side Highlights
7.9
๐ŸŒ‹

Ponta de Sรฃo Lourenรงo

The dramatic eastern peninsula of Madeira with its unique reddish volcanic soil and jagged cliffs visible shortly after takeoff.

๐ŸŒŠ

North Atlantic Ocean

Expansive views of the deep blue Atlantic, often showing the wake of transatlantic vessels during the cruise phase.

โ˜˜๏ธ

Irish Atlantic Coast

On clear days, the rugged southwestern tip of Ireland and the Skellig Islands may be visible in the distance.

๐Ÿ”๏ธ

Isle of Arran

Known as Scotland in Miniature, offering stunning views of Goatfell and the northern granite peaks during descent.

๐ŸŒฒ

The Trossachs

Distant views of the forested hills and lochs marking the start of the Scottish Highlands as the plane turns for arrival.

Choose the left side for evening flights to enjoy the sunset over the ocean. Keep a keen eye out as you cross the Irish Sea for the first glimpse of the rugged Scottish coastline and the Mull of Kintyre.
